Adelaide ranks 185th in number of biographies on Pantheon, behind Nice, Salvador, Bahia, and Mannheim. Memorable people born in Adelaide include Lawrence Bragg, Sia, and Robin Warren. Memorable people who died in Adelaide include George Szekeres, Melissa Hoskins, and Gillian Rolton. Adelaide has been the birth place of many actors, and cyclists and the death place of many mathematicians, and cyclists. Adelaide is located in Australia.

Adelaide is the capital and most populous city of South Australia, as well as the fifth-most populous city in Australia. The name "Adelaide" may refer to either Greater Adelaide or the Adelaide city centre; the demonym Adelaidean is used to denote the city and the residents of Adelaide. The traditional owners of the Adelaide region are the Kaurna, with the name Tarndanya referring to the area of the city centre and surrounding Park Lands, in the Kaurna language. Adelaide is situated on the Adelaide Plains north of the Fleurieu Peninsula, between the Gulf St Vincent in the west and the Mount Lofty Ranges in the east. Its metropolitan area extends 20 km (12 mi) from the coast to the foothills of the Mount Lofty Ranges, and stretches 96 km (60 mi) from Gawler in the north to Sellicks Beach in the south.
